Take Your Time. Breathe. Repeat.

We live in a world that revolves around instant gratification.  Texting, emails, social media, Starbucks, theres even an app that brings you gas so that you don’t have to go to the gas station….Cray.  All of these things save time and help us get what we need fast.  Don’t get me wrong, I think all of these things are amazing!  But as creatives that are trying so hard to turn our passion into a career, we tend to get so impatient.  We “hustle” so hard that we become blind to the time that we’ve wasted and start to get discouraged that we’re not where we want to be in life right this second.  Our fast food mentality makes us forget how far we’ve come.  We forget to savor the journey and forget where we came from and where we’ve been.  We forget to thank friends and family that have been there since day one, supporting us every single step of the way.  We forget that good things truly do take time.  I am so guilty of this and will be the first to say that I spend way too much time comparing my journey to other’s and complaining that I’m not exactly where I want to be in life.  While a future living in Orange County closer to my girlfriend and being booked all year round sounds amazingly ideal, I need to take a second to chill out and remember how blessed I am right now in this moment.  I’ve been placed in this exact spot for a specific reason.  Yes, our future should definitely be our fuel, but keep in mind that in any journey there are going to be pit stops and set backs along the way.  I, you, WE will definitely get to our goal.  Keep working hard.  But please.

Take your time.

Breathe.

Repeat.
